8-K
filed 2026-08-25
confidence 92%
Item 5.02
The filing discloses the appointment of Benjamin J. Branstetter as Chief Financial Officer effective September 1, 2026, succeeding William A. Byers. While the section also includes Brent B. Secrest's appointment as President – Logistics and Transportation and William A. Byers' retirement, the most material and salient event is Branstetter's appointment to the CFO role, a C-suite position critical to financial oversight. The appointment includes compensatory modifications (increased base salary to $600,000 and long-term incentive award of 400% of base salary), underscoring its significance.

8-K
filed 2026-08-06
confidence 98%
Item 2.02
Targa Resources Corp. disclosed its financial results for the three and six months ended June 30, 2026, reporting net income of $765 million (up 22% year-over-year) and record adjusted EBITDA of $1,603 million (up 38%), along with updated full-year 2026 guidance and detailed segment performance analysis.

8-K
filed 2026-07-17
confidence 95%
Item 5.02
The filing discloses the appointment of Thomas Mathiasmeier to the Board of Directors as a Class II Director on July 16, 2026, and his concurrent appointment to the Audit Committee. While the disclosure also mentions compensatory arrangements (a pro-rated restricted stock award of 477 shares), the principal disclosed action is the appointment itself. Mathiasmeier's substantial experience as President of Global Gas, Power & Emerging Markets at ConocoPhillips and his industry expertise make this a material governance event affecting the composition and expertise of the Board.

8-K
filed 2026-07-06
confidence 75%
Item 1.01
Targa Resources entered into a Seventeenth Amendment to its Receivables Purchase Agreement on July 1, 2026, extending the Facility Termination Date to July 30, 2027 and establishing a new uncommitted $200 million line. With approximately $451 million in outstanding trade receivable purchases, this amendment materially modifies the company's financing structure and credit facility. While this is technically an amendment to an existing securitization facility rather than a new debt issuance, it creates new financial obligations and extends the company's access to capital, which falls within the debt_issuance category as it represents a material creation or amendment of a direct financial obligation.
